#NoJunkJourney with Organix | Organix Halloween Frankenstein Toast


In a bid to help parents and children join in with the fun of Halloween, but ditch the junk, Organix has come up with some truly awful treats that are actually good for you. Happy Halloween folks! 

Suitable for 12+ months
10-30 minutes to prepare
Under 10 minutes to cook
2 pieces of toast (serves 2 children)



Ingredients

2 open cap mushrooms
A drizzle of vegetable oil for cooking
2 slices of wholemeal bread
½ a large ripe avocado
Squeeze of lemon
½ a large tomato
4 tsps. sesame seeds 
4 pumpkin seeds
½ a cucumber
How to make
Step 1

Finely chop the mushrooms, then sauté over a medium heat with a drizzle of oil

Step 2

Toast the bread, then mash a quarter of the avocado onto each slice, adding a tiny squeeze of lemon to stop the avocado going brown

Step 3


Cut the halved tomato in half again, then cut two zig zag mouths from each half, and a triangle nose. Add these onto the avocado toast

Step 4

Place the sautéed mushrooms along the top of the toast to look like Frankenstein hair

Step 5 

Then carefully add a teaspoon of sesame seeds for each round eye, adding one pumpkin seed into the centre of each eye as the pupil

 
Step 6

Finally cut the cucumber into 8 pieces - make 4 of them approx. 3cm x 2cm, and the other 4 approx. 2cm x 1cm. Add these to the sides of the toast at the bottom to make Frankenstein bolts! The smaller batons on the inside, with the larger ones as screws on the outside. Serve immediately
